CVE-2025-46060
CVE-2025-46060
Weakness (CWE)
CVSS Vector
v3.1- Attack Vector
- Network
- Attack Complexity
- Low
- Privileges Required
- None
- User Interaction
- None
- Scope
- Unchanged
- Confidentiality
- High
- Integrity
- High
- Availability
- High
Description
Buffer Overflow vulnerability in TOTOLINK N600R v4.3.0cu.7866_B2022506 allows a remote attacker to execute arbitrary code via the UPLOAD_FILENAME component
Comprehensive Technical Analysis of CVE-2025-46060
1. Vulnerability Assessment and Severity Evaluation
CVE ID: CVE-2025-46060 Description: Buffer Overflow vulnerability in TOTOLINK N600R v4.3.0cu.7866_B2022506 allows a remote attacker to execute arbitrary code via the UPLOAD_FILENAME component. CVSS Score: 9.8
Severity Evaluation: The CVSS score of 9.8 indicates a critical vulnerability. This high score is due to the potential for remote code execution, which can lead to complete system compromise. The vulnerability allows an attacker to execute arbitrary code, potentially leading to data breaches, unauthorized access, and further exploitation of the network.
2. Potential Attack Vectors and Exploitation Methods
Attack Vectors:
- Remote Exploitation: An attacker can exploit this vulnerability over the network without requiring physical access to the device.
- Malicious File Upload: The attacker can craft a specially designed file with a long filename that, when uploaded, triggers the buffer overflow.
Exploitation Methods:
- Buffer Overflow: The attacker can send a specially crafted UPLOAD_FILENAME parameter that exceeds the buffer size, leading to a buffer overflow.
- Code Execution: By carefully crafting the payload, the attacker can inject and execute arbitrary code on the affected device.
3. Affected Systems and Software Versions
Affected Systems:
- TOTOLINK N600R routers running firmware version v4.3.0cu.7866_B2022506.
Software Versions:
- The vulnerability specifically affects TOTOLINK N600R v4.3.0cu.7866_B2022506. Other versions may also be affected but have not been explicitly mentioned in the CVE details.
4. Recommended Mitigation Strategies
Immediate Actions:
- Firmware Update: Immediately update the firmware to a version that addresses this vulnerability. If an update is not available, consider using alternative firmware that is known to be secure.
- Network Segmentation: Isolate the affected devices on a separate network segment to limit potential damage.
- Access Control: Restrict access to the device's management interface to trusted IP addresses only.
Long-Term Strategies:
- Regular Patching: Implement a regular patching and update schedule for all network devices.
- Intrusion Detection: Deploy intrusion detection systems (IDS) to monitor for suspicious activity.
- Security Audits: Conduct regular security audits and vulnerability assessments to identify and mitigate potential risks.
5. Impact on Cybersecurity Landscape
Broader Implications:
- Supply Chain Risks: This vulnerability highlights the risks associated with IoT devices and the importance of secure firmware development.
- Remote Attack Surface: The ability to exploit this vulnerability remotely increases the attack surface, making it a significant threat to network security.
- Reputation and Trust: Vendors must prioritize security to maintain customer trust and avoid reputational damage.
Industry Response:
- Vendor Responsibility: Vendors should prioritize security in their product development lifecycle and provide timely updates and patches.
- Community Collaboration: The cybersecurity community should collaborate to share threat intelligence and mitigation strategies.
6. Technical Details for Security Professionals
Vulnerability Details:
- Buffer Overflow: The vulnerability occurs due to insufficient bounds checking on the UPLOAD_FILENAME parameter, leading to a buffer overflow.
- Exploit Code: The exploit code is available on GitHub, as referenced in the CVE details. Security professionals can analyze the code to understand the exploitation method and develop detection signatures.
Detection and Response:
- Log Analysis: Monitor logs for unusual activity related to file uploads and buffer overflows.
- Signature-Based Detection: Develop and deploy signatures for IDS/IPS systems to detect and block exploitation attempts.
- Incident Response: Have an incident response plan in place to quickly address any detected exploitation attempts.
References:
By addressing this vulnerability promptly and implementing robust security measures, organizations can mitigate the risks associated with CVE-2025-46060 and enhance their overall cybersecurity posture.